A Discussion about the Impact of ChatGPT in Education: Benefits and Concerns

Charles Alves de Castro

Abstract


The advent of advanced machine learning models such as ChatGPT has led to significant advancements in various fields, including education. The purpose of this article is to explore the impact of ChatGPT in higher education, covering both positive and negative nuances. A critical literature review analysis was conducted, which included references from reliable sources. The methodology used in this article was based on a critical literature review method. The results of the analysis indicate that ChatGPT might have several benefits in education, including improved student engagement, personalized learning experiences, and enhanced teaching practices. However, there are also some negative implications, such as concerns over privacy, academic integrity, and the potential for bias. The article concludes by highlighting the need for further research in this area and providing recommendations for educators and policymakers.
